Quincy, Illinois, USA – IIC Acquisitions, founded by BE’s VP of Engineering, Brian Lindemann (pictured), has acquired all outstanding units and increased ownership in Broadcast Electronics to 100%.
“This is a great day for BE and a great day for our customers,” said Tom Beck, President and CEO. “BE has been owned by a number of private equity firms over the years and this is the right ownership direction at the perfect time as we look to the future. With Brian as owner, there is no doubt that we will be able to focus even more on customers and the best equipment to serve their needs.”
Lindemann joined BE as VP of Engineering in 2008. Prior to BE, his career included design and development of high tech communication products. Brian holds eight patents and specializes in waveform generation with an emphasis on hardware/software co-design. Lindemann is also a Six Sigma Black Belt.
I recognize the potential for this company and am excited about this next step in my career at BE,” said Lindemann. “BE’s name is very well known and our history includes serving thousands of customers worldwide with both our transmitters and our AudioVAULT automation software. From the business view, we have had three terrific years and have had a great start in 2016. I am excited about our near and long-term prospects and once again putting our focus in the technology arena. Acquiring BE is a no-brainer for me and I am really looking forward to our future.”
About Broadcast Electronics
Established in 1959, BE provides award winning FM and AM transmitters, AudioVAULT studio automation, Marti Electronics STL and RPU solutions, and Commotion™, a social media, advertising, and listener interactive solutions company.
